SensoryCo Scenting System Enhances 4D Experience at the Aquarium of the Pacific in Long Beach, California
By Michelle Roe • October 24, 2019This past summer, the Aquarium of the Pacific debuted its new wing, Pacific Visions. The expansion of the existing aquarium facility was realized with a 29,000- square-foot, two-story, building that blends state of the art technology with sustainable design features. The venue is a wondrous place for guests to explore nature’s gifts through live animal… -
